Overview:

The Home Health LPN provides skilled nursing care to patients in their homes under the supervision of a Registered Nurse. They provide service in accordance with the Home Health Agency (HHA) philosophy, standards, policies and scope of practice.

Responsibilities:

Provides skilled nursing in the home as ordered on the plan of treatment and nursing care plan.

Evaluates the significance of assessment findings and communicates any pertinent information about the patient’s clinical status and ongoing needs to others in a timely fashion

Assess and reassess pain. Utilizes appropriate pain management techniques. Educates the patient and family regarding pain management.

Demonstrates knowledge of medications and their correct administration based on age of the patient and patient’s clinical position.

Follows the seven (7) medication rights and reduces the potential for medication errors.

Performs all aspects of patient care in an environment that optimizes patient safety and reduces the likelihood of medical/health care errors.

Functions as a team member demonstrating collaboration with, and responsibility to patient, physician, interdisciplinary team.

Adheres to all HHA, payroll, billing and documentation policies and procedures.

Participates in HHA’s other mandated activities, as requested by Clinical Supervisor or Patient Care Services Director including in-services and Upper Respiratory (UR)/ Perfusion Index (PI) committee.

Performs patient care responsibilities considering needs to the standard of care for patient’s age.

Articulates HHA grievance/concerns procedure.

Articulates HHA adverse event/incident reporting procedure.

Articulates organization’s emergency management plan.

Assists the physician and registered nurse to perform specialized procedures.

Works as part of the interdisciplinary team.

Completes patient documentation on time.

Attends in-services and staff meetings as needed.

Completes assigned training on time.

Completes annual education requirements.

Maintains patient confidentiality at all times.

Performs other duties as assigned.

Qualifications:

Graduate of an accredited nursing program.

Current state licensure as a LPN.

Experience as an LPN commensurate with one of the following:

One (1) year experience in an acute care setting within the last 24 months;

Six (6) months home care experience within the last 12 months.

Prior home healthcare experience is preferred.

Valid state driver’s license and reliable automobile, current automobile insurance and being willing to operate personal car(s) necessitated by nature of job.

Current TB testing.

Current CPR card.

No findings relating to client abuse, neglect, or misappropriation of client property.
